Since 1934, team scoring officially became a permanent feature of the NCAA Wrestling Championships. In 1928 and from 1931–1933, there was only an unofficial team title. Oklahoma A&M (now Oklahoma State) won the 1928 and 1931 unofficial titles. See more The NCAA Division I Wrestling Championships have been held since 1928. Oklahoma State. Oklahoma State led by the legendary John Smith is the number 1 college wrestling team of all time. The Oklahoma State Cowboys wrestling has won 34 team titles and produced 142 individual champions both of which are the most of any NCAA ... reflowing an automobile computer boardWeb2 days ago · He will be competing alongside fellow GWC athlete Hayden Zillmer, the 2024 World Team member at 125 kilograms.
